Milford Sound Experience - TouringTake an unforgettable journey through the magical Milford Sound and experience the true beauty of the South Island. Discover the history of this world famous region, travel through awe-inspiring landscapes, and see glacier carved valleys and dramatic cascading waterfalls.

One thousand years ago, Maori travelled overland to Milford in search of the much prized pounamu (greenstone). These treks from the east used traditional pathways across passes such as Mackinnon Pass on the Milford Track. Today, this Milford experience follows in the footsteps of the ancient Maori and takes you deep into Fiordland National Park.

Journey through the Homer tunnel, a 1.2km tunnel drilled through solid rock. Hear the legends of the gold miners and how they prospected for gold in the rugged ranges. View the beautiful Mirror lakes before navigating over the footbridge at the imposing and spectacular Chasm.

On arrival at Milford Sound you have two options:

Option One: The Encounter

Board the Encounter Cruise for a 2.5 hour intimate and interactive exploration of Milford Sound. See the imposing sight of Mitre Peak rising 1,692m (5,560ft) from the sea as roving guides keep you informed with their local knowledge and experience of the Fiord. A delicious snackbox lunch is included onboard your cruise (Available from October 1 2010).

Option Two: The Discovery

Deepen your understanding at the Milford Sound Discovery Centre of the fiord’s formation, the Maori explorers who first found Piopotahi (Milford Sound), and early European tourism. Then, descend 10m underwater into a spacious chamber with views of the rich marine ecosystem, its primeval creatures and rare Black Coral.
